Subject: Bounce processor update rolling out tonight

Team, we are deploying a fix to the Mallowgate bounce processor that corrects misclassification of soft bounces as permanent failures. Support should expect a brief backlog as queued notifications reprocess between 02:00 and 03:00 local time. Suppression lists will be rebuilt automatically afterward. For reference when filing escalations, the deployed build identifier appears below.

trace token, fafog-kageg: htk4_98e6

Runbook bit — Carton export retries. When the nightly export to the Ostrel warehouse flakes (it will), don't panic: the retry worker picks up failures automatically with backoff, and most clear within an hour. If the failure count keeps climbing past three cycles, check the upstream auth token first — that's the culprit nine times out of ten. Only page the data team if retries exhaust. Before the release goes out, double-check the worker is running with the settings below.

deployment values, yadug-bawif:
[framir]
team = pelox
access_code = ac_a38ab2
owner = tamion.julael
host = framir.tolvaqlabs.test
port = 11211
peer = tammir.zemvargrid.local
salt = 2215ef03
pin = 1541

**Q: What do I need before approving the Quillbase migration to the Hermit build system?** Verify that every target declares its inputs explicitly — no reads outside the sandbox. The legacy Makefiles fetched toolchains at build time; Hermit pins them in the lockfile. Reject any change that shells out to the network. If you need to unlock the sealed toolchain cache to diff artifacts, use the recovery passphrase below:

strongbox words: prawyn-fenmir

Subject: Cron migration — what you need to know

Welcome to the rotation. We're moving all legacy cron jobs on the batch hosts into Weftline, our workflow engine. About half are migrated. If a cron fires twice or not at all, check whether it's been cut over before digging in — dual-running is the usual culprit. The migration tracker lists every job, its status, and its owner.

runbook for tafof-yawif: https://confluence.tolvaqsys.internal/display/display/browse/pages/7be3